Vulnerability Trends for This Vendor

SecUtils has indexed 4 known vulnerabilities from himmelblau-idm. This includes 1 critical-severity issue and 2 high-severity issues that represent significant risk. These vulnerabilities affect 1 distinct product across himmelblau-idm's portfolio, demonstrating the breadth of the vendor's product ecosystem and the importance of comprehensive patch management strategies. Disclosure dates span from 2025 through 2026, with recent active disclosure activity. Organizations deploying himmelblau-idm products should maintain active vulnerability monitoring, prioritize critical patches, and implement compensating controls where patches cannot be applied immediately.

ID Date Published Last Modified Severity (CVSSv3) Severity (CVSSv2) Exploit Available
CVE-2025-54882 2025-08-07 2026-06-17 7.1 - -
CVE-2026-31957 2026-03-11 2026-06-17 10.0 - -
CVE-2026-31979 2026-03-11 2026-06-17 8.8 - -
CVE-2026-34397 2026-04-01 2026-06-17 6.3 - -
